Send Me a Song

Send me a song, if it’s all you can do; Send me a song, I’ve got one for you too; Send me the rhythm, send me your rhymes; Show me that smile, freeze that look in your eyes; Send me a song, shield me with your melody; Like a blanket, cover me; Drown me in a scream, hear the lightest moan; A magnetic symphony Criss cross your words, Don’t forget the tone; See through your goosebumps, taste the energy in the air; Smell strawberries, sip champagne; Send me your song send me over the moon I’ll bring the rhythm Now play for me, I dare you.
